The static-analysis baseline for the Harrowfield payments service was regenerated after last night's scanner upgrade, and the diff shows 312 suppressions removed and 9 added. On-call should not merge this automatically: the new suppressions touch input-validation rules, which our policy flags as high-risk. Please verify the nine additions against the upgrade notes, attach your review comments, and hold the merge until sign-off is recorded. Sign-off authority for baseline changes belongs to the person named below.

named custodian: Brivan Eliath Quenox Frador

INTERNAL MEMO — Gross-Margin Review

To: Sales Leads
From: Finance, Torvane Industries

Q2 gross margin slipped 1.8 points, driven by discounting on the Ardent line and freight overruns. Effective immediately: discounts above 12% require director approval; bundle pricing frozen pending review. Updated margin targets circulate Friday. Compliance will be tracked weekly. The confidential business-plan note appears below.

internal memo for kawip-hadug: Headcount on the Wenwyn team goes from 7 to 140 by the end of January. Gross margin on Wenwyn came in at 20 percent against a plan of 15 percent.

## Idempotency Keys for Payment Retries (Lumopay)

Every retry of a charge request must reuse the original idempotency key; generating a new key on retry can produce duplicate charges. Keys are scoped per merchant and expire after 48 hours. Reviewers should verify keys are derived server-side, never from client input. The full key-generation specification and threat model are maintained on the internal page.

dashboard of kaguf-tawip = https://vault.merlaqsys.test/issue

Ticket: Schema registry drift affecting plugin compatibility

The Oakmere event schema registry in the partner environment has drifted from the published reference: two compatibility modes were changed without a corresponding changelog entry, which can cause plugin-emitted events to be rejected at validation. Plugin authors should not work around this locally; a corrective rollout is scheduled. For transparency, the partner environment is currently operating with the configuration below.

config for kafof-bawef:
holath:
  log_level: debug
  metrics_host: metrics.holath.qorvelsys.internal
  pin: 2191
  pool_size: 32